When an information event warrants a disruption of existing non-news programs (or, in some situations, frequently arranged newscasts), the broadcaster will normally inform all of its associates, telling them to stand by for the interruption.


If a nationwide network broadcast is in progression when the damaging information event takes place, the newscast will stop briefly to permit various other network associates to sign up with the feed., that welcomes the audience to the program and introduces the tale at hand.


Breaking report are typically insufficient because reporters have only a basic recognition of the tale. As an example, major U.S. program networks assessed the search warrant testimony associated to the FBI search of Mar-a-Lago in real time, while on the air, burglarizing programming immediately after the file was launched.

Damaging information reports usually face the same issues in coverage: no video footage of the occurrence, no reporters at the scene, and little available info. To be able to report on current affairs regardless of this, several networks either use full-time (common in the USA) or call freelance (typical in the United Kingdom) experts and pundits to be "speaking heads".


They have been typical on tv, and can likewise show up on radio. In the United States, the competitive nature of commercial networks has enabled pundits to develop their skills and dedicate themselves to reply to damaging information with analysis in a selection of fields, usually political. These speaking heads can be paid millions to function solely for a network.




They are not permanent staff members of networks and are not always paid when they are it is a flat cost for the slot and will be quickly contacted to discuss the pertinent field (in which they will generally function full time). Experts in the UK have actually said that they do it due to the fact that they consider it vital to obtain expert insurance coverage of breaking information, and because it can place their field (and themselves) in the limelight.

For instance, during the Sago Mine catastrophe, there were preliminary records that 12 of the 13 miners were found navigate here alive, however information organizations later discovered that only one in see here fact endured. Some commentators examine as to whether the use of the term "breaking information" is too much, pointing out events when the term is used despite the fact that set up programming is not interrupted.

Being the initial to report on an occasion or having a tale-- a "scoop" as reporters call it-- is ending up being harder. In the past, when there was a disaster or an essential news occasion, press reporters would a regular tv or radio broadcast. They commonly stated, "We interrupt this program for an essential statement." They did not make use of words "breaking news" since it was clear they were "getting into" the routine program.
